What does 'GS' in the product name mean?

GS stands for 'Grade School,' indicating that these shoes are specifically designed and sized for school-aged children.

Are these shoes suitable for running sports?

While inspired by running aesthetics and featuring cushioning, the ASICS GEL-1130 GS is best suited for everyday wear, school activities, walking, and light recreational play rather than competitive running or specialized sports.

How often should I clean these shoes?

The frequency depends on usage. For active children, cleaning every 1-2 weeks or as needed when visibly dirty will help maintain their appearance and longevity. Always air dry completely.

What is GEL technology?

GEL technology is a cushioning system developed by ASICS that uses silicone-based material strategically placed in the shoe, typically in the heel and/or forefoot, to absorb shock and reduce impact during movement, enhancing comfort.

What materials are these shoes made from?

The upper of the ASICS GEL-1130 GS is made from 100% synthetic materials, offering durability and a modern look. The sole typically comprises rubber and various cushioning/support components.

How can I ensure I get the correct size for my child?

It's best to measure your child's foot from heel to the longest toe. Compare this measurement to ASICS's sizing chart for children. Always allow for a small amount of growth room, typically about a thumb's width past the longest toe.

Troubleshooting

My child's feet feel hot or sweaty.

Ensure your child is wearing appropriate socks (e.g., moisture-wicking materials) for the activity level and weather. The synthetic upper, while durable, may not offer the same breathability as some mesh designs. Ensure the shoes are not laced too tightly, restricting air flow.

The shoes are getting dirty very quickly.

Regular cleaning is key for synthetic materials. Follow the 'Product Care' instructions provided. For tough dirt, a gentle scrub brush can be more effective than just a cloth. Consider using a protective spray designed for synthetic footwear, although this may alter the finish.

My child complains about discomfort after wearing them for a while.

First, double-check the sizing to ensure there's enough room for toes to move and no pressure points. Break-in periods vary; if new, allow a few more days of light wear. Ensure socks are not bunched up. If discomfort persists, consult a shoe specialist to check for fit or gait issues.

The sole seems to be losing grip.

Check the outsole for excessive wear or embedded debris. Clean the tread patterns thoroughly to remove any dirt or small stones that might be reducing grip. If the tread is significantly worn down, the shoes may need to be replaced for optimal safety.

Product Care

  • Cleaning: Due to its 100% synthetic material, cleaning is straightforward:
  1. Brush off loose dirt and mud with a soft brush (e.g., old toothbrush).
  2. Mix mild soap (like dish soap) with lukewarm water.
  3. Use a soft cloth or sponge, dipped in the soapy water, to gently wipe down the entire shoe.
  4. For stubborn spots, use a soft brush with the soapy water.
  5. Rinse the cloth with clean water and wipe down the shoes to remove soap residue.
  6. Let the shoes air dry completely at room temperature, away from direct sunlight or heat sources, which can damage materials.
  • Drying: Never put synthetic shoes in a washing machine or tumble dryer, as this can damage the materials and adhesives.
  • Storage: Store shoes in a cool, dry place when not in use. Avoid prolonged exposure to extreme temperatures.
  • Odor Control: If odors develop, remove insoles (if removable) and air them out. You can also use shoe deodorizers.
